How jump rope calorie estimates work

If you are searching for “how many calories does jump rope burn,” this calculator gives a pace-based estimate from your body weight and session duration. It uses three conditioning-exercise MET values: 8.8 for slow, 11.8 for moderate and 12.3 for fast jump rope.

A MET, or metabolic equivalent of a task, expresses the energy cost of an activity compared with resting. Pace matters because it changes the intensity and therefore the MET value; duration tells us how long that intensity continues, but ten minutes fast is not the same effort as ten minutes slow.

The running comparison uses 8.3 METs for running at 8 km/h (5 mph). It answers how many minutes of that running would use the same estimated calories, not which workout is better.

Calories per minute = MET × 3.5 × body weight (kg) ÷ 200; total calories = calories per minute × minutes

This is an estimate, not a measurement. MET values are population averages, and real burn varies with technique, rest between sets, fitness and body composition. Body weight in pounds is converted to kilograms before the equation is applied.

Jump rope calories FAQ

How many calories does jump rope burn in 10 minutes?

It depends on weight and pace. For a 70 kg person, this estimate is about 108 calories at a slow pace, 145 at a moderate pace or 151 at a fast pace for 10 minutes. Those are estimates, not measurements.

Does jump rope burn more calories than running?

In this comparison, all three jump rope pace values are higher than the 8.3 MET value used for running at 8 km/h, so jump rope burns more per minute in the estimate. Actual burn depends on how you move, how often you rest and how steadily you hold the pace.

Why does a heavier person burn more calories?

The standard MET equation multiplies by body weight in kilograms. With the same pace and duration, moving a heavier body requires more energy in the population-average estimate.

How accurate is a MET calorie estimate?

It is useful for comparison and planning, but it is not a personal measurement. METs are population averages; technique, rest between sets, fitness, body composition and how closely your pace matches the category can all change real energy use.

What does the running-equivalent number mean?

It is the number of minutes of running at 8 km/h that would use the same estimated calories as your jump rope session, using 8.3 METs for running. It does not compare the workouts’ training effects or difficulty.
